Blocking Fundamentals
In advance of diving into certain drills, it is vital to grasp the basic principles of blocking:

Positioning: Stand shoulder-width apart, knees bent, and palms ready earlier mentioned your head.

Timing: Jump since the hitter swings, not right before or right after.

Hand Placement: Fingers unfold, thumbs pointed a little bit towards one another, and palms angled towards the opponent’s court docket.

Footwork: Fast lateral movement along the net is key for double blocks or subsequent a hitter.

Prime Blocking Drills
Here are several volleyball blocking drills that are helpful for beginners and creating gamers:

one. Mirror Movement Drill
This drill focuses on footwork and response pace. Two players encounter one another over the Internet. A single player functions because the “hitter” and moves side-to-facet along The online, even though the blocker mirrors their movements. It increases lateral quickness and positioning.

2. Penetration Drill
Players practice blocking versus a wall or Internet, concentrating exclusively on urgent their fingers around The web. Coaches emphasize reaching ahead, not only upward, to produce a robust, penetrating block that directs the ball down into your opponent’s court.

three. Read-and-React Drill
A coach or player tosses balls to different hitters on the opposite aspect. The blocker will have to go through which hitter is receiving the ball and shift to dam accordingly. This aids acquire anticipation and studying the setter or hitter’s human body language.

four. Bounce https://bot88.app/ Timing Drill
Employing a gradual-movement solution from the mentor or teammate, the blocker techniques timing their soar accurately as the hitter reaches peak Speak to. Repetition will help acquire rhythm and regularity in blocking timing.

5. Block-to-Changeover Drill
After a block attempt, the participant speedily drops into defensive posture or transitions into offense. This is particularly worthwhile for middle blockers who will have to return to action instantly following leaping.
